Repairing Double Glazed Windows

When double glazed windows "blow" in the wind, argon that is insulating escapes, causing the window to lose energy efficiency. The good thing is that double glazing can often be repaired without having to replace your windows completely.

Replacement-Windows-150x150.jpgMoisture or condensation in between your double glazed windows is a typical sign that the seals on your windows are failing. It can be easily fixed by a professional, which will save you the cost of a new window replacement near me.

Take the Glass off

Unlike single pane windows, double-glazed windows feature two glass panes that are separated by a spacer and layer of air which provides insulation. The insulated glass unit (IGU) can be filled with gases like Krypton or argon to provide better insulation. These units are susceptible to being damaged as time passes and stop functioning properly. It is essential to remove any broken glass as safely and quickly as possible.

Replacing double-glazed windows can be a difficult DIY job that requires specialised tools and expertise. This is why it is often best left to a professional who can use the proper safety equipment and follow the proper procedure to prevent injuries.

This is particularly important as double-glazed windows can be fragile and easy to break or crack. Wear a respirator, gloves and mask to safeguard yourself when working on the window doctor. Make sure that the area around the window frame is free of debris and clean. Then, you need to place a thick sheet of plastic over the area that will be shaved by the deglazing tool to catch the fragments of glass that have broken and make it easier to remove them.

Remove the Gaskets

Double glazing is a fantastic method of increasing the energy efficiency of your home, however it will wear out over time. Damages that are visible, draughts, and condensation are all indicators that it's time for you to repair or replace your double-glazed windows.

The gasket is a crucial component of the window assembly. It is a neoprene-based rubber seal that cushions and shields the glass from weather. Deterioration of the gaskets is a common reason for leaks and the infiltration of moisture into buildings. Fortunately, these seals can be replaced without replacing the whole window.

Gaskets can be repaired by pinching them and removing them. It is much easier to repair uPVC frames rather than aluminum or timber. If you're not able to remove the seals by hand, it's a good idea to use a builder's knife to pry away the seal until you are able to grip it with your fingers. Once the seal has been removed and replaced, you'll be able to replace it with a new seal to ensure a snug fit and maximum efficiency.

After the seals have been replaced the window beading will need to be removed. You can use a putty or lead knife to remove the window beading. Place the blade of the knife between the frame and bead in the middle of the longest bead. This will give you the greatest leverage to separate the bead from the frame.

After all the beading has been removed, you can then remove the window glass. For optimum thermal efficiency, the gap between two panes should be 12mm. Argon gas should be used to fill this space. A bigger gap could be used to reduce the sound levels however it can reduce the insulation capacity of windows.

Re-seal the Window

It could be time to seal your double-glazed windows if you notice that they're fogged up or have moisture between them. This type of problem is a clear indicator that the seal inside has failed to keep the insulating gases in. It is not uncommon for the rubber seal that keeps in the insulating gases to degrade as time passes or due to an improper installation.

A professional window specialist will seal the glass unit by applying a new seal around each of the individual gaps of insulation. The technician will use silicone caulk to close the gaps. This will keep cold air out and warm air in during winter. The caulk also stops bugs from entering your home, and it will prevent moisture from getting into your home, too.

Re-sealing double glazed windows is not a simple DIY project. But it is doable. It is a tedious and time-consuming task that requires special tools to get rid of the old caulk, wash the area, and then apply a new one. It is a good idea to get a professional glazier for the work to avoid injuries and to ensure that the work is done properly.

In some instances double-glazed glass windows can't be repaired and will need to be replaced completely. This could include cracked or shattered glass, extensive damage to the frame, or serious decay. It is recommended to consult with a double glazing expert to determine what the best solution is in these instances.

The misting of windows is usually a sign of a failed treatment of the glass at the factory. The factory will apply a low-emissivity layer on the window to reflect heat. They could also inject an argon gas for additional insulation. If these treatments fail, moisture gets into the gap between the glass panes and it could cause condensation. This issue can be resolved by a professional who drills tiny holes through the glass panes and then piping into a dehydrating solution to remove the moisture. The professional will then fill the gap with a new gas that is insulating, and seal it without the gas from escaping.
